WOLFE, Tom
[243] pp.
Farrar, Straus and Giroux
1976
First Printing
8 3/8" x 5 5/8"
Jacket design by Janet Halverson
Consisting of eleven essays and one short story that Wolfe wrote between 1967 and 1976. It includes the essay in which he coined the term "the 'Me' Decade" to refer to the 1970s.
